It was bad..... oil in the compressor side..... should just be a seal.

New turbo went in pretty easily, just required some persuasion to get the downpipe hooked up. Have a leak at the downpipe to turbo mating surface, probably just need a new gasket....

Looks great in the engine bay, and it should spool much faster with the new 48 ar turbine as opposed to the old 63 ar. !
